Leicester, NC is an unincorporated community located in Buncombe County, North Carolina. It has a total population of 157 people and it ranked #5 on the BestPlaces list of “Best Places to Raise a Family in Buncombe County\". Leicester offers its residents a sparse suburban feel with many amenities close by. The city has great public schools, low crime rates, and lots of outdoor activities. Residents can enjoy visiting the nearby forests, lakes, and parks for outdoor recreation. Additionally, Leicester provides a friendly and welcoming atmosphere for families to thrive in. Overall, Leicester is an excellent place to raise a family due to its low costs of living and high rankings on the BestPlaces list.
